Do you know what size fittings are on your AE kit? You might not find a thermostatic plate with those sizes. I thought the AE kit came with a thermostatic plate, but I guess it was just an optional piece like on most oil cooler kits.
|
You could always buy a Mocal thermostatic plate and just switch the AN fittings to match.
Find a buddy with a set of AN fittings to test size. I can almost guarantee they are either -8 or -10AN. |
